Loughborough Amherst School is a All-through, Co-Ed, Roman Catholic school located in Leicestershire, East Midlands.

It has 438 students from age 4-18 yr.

Tuition fee £4,040 to £5,270 for the highest grade offered.

From the Loughborough Amherst School
It is our responsibility to make sure your child graduates from school with self-assurance, empathy, and ambition. The Independent Schools Inspectorate has recognised us as "outstanding" in every category. Instead of having meaningless, materialistic desire, people should strive to use the skills and information they have acquired to reach their full potential and improve the world. a demanding, knowledge-rich curriculum with high standards for all students. A sincere commitment to providing individualised attention to each family and each student in our care. Our overall teacher to pupil ratio is an amazing 1 to 7.6, and no class has more than 20 students. The Minerva concept is an educational method that permeates all element of school life and is created with the single goal of assisting students in becoming competitive adults while also promoting happiness, health, balance, and kindness. More information about Minerva can be found here. a broad and varied extracurricular programme that is made better by our affiliation with the Loughborough Schools Foundation, especially in the areas of music and sport. A flexible curriculum and the capacity to accommodate a variety of learning styles that larger non-selective schools or more selective institutions may not always be able to match. Although we are pleased to be a Catholic school at Loughborough Amherst, we do not strive to force any doctrinal ideas on any of our community members. In addition to students whose homes are completely secular, the school has Anglicans, Methodists, Muslims, Hindus, and Buddhists among its students. All people who value perseverance, modesty, compassion, service, and respect for others are welcome here.
